Dying Moments
This is the wreck of the MS Riverdance, a RoRo ferry that operated across the Irish sea. During a storm in January 2008, a broadside hit from a wave shifted her cargo and she started to list. She subsequently lost an engine and finally beached on the shore just north of Blackpool. All attempts to re float her failed and when this was taken, she was in the process of being cut up. The sunset marking of the end of the day during the imminent end of her days struck me as being poignant. Hence the title.
